news 2026/4/16 11:00:53

knowledge-grab:高效解决教育资源下载难题的专业工具

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
knowledge-grab:高效解决教育资源下载难题的专业工具

面对丰富多样的教育资源却难以批量获取的困境,knowledge-grab教育资源下载工具应运而生。这款基于Tauri和Vue 3构建的跨平台下载软件,专门针对国家中小学智慧教育平台的课件、视频等学习材料提供高效下载解决方案,让教师备课和学生自学变得轻松便捷。

【免费下载链接】knowledge-grabknowledge-grab 是一个基于 Tauri 和 Vue 3 构建的桌面应用程序,方便用户从 国家中小学智慧教育平台 (basic.smartedu.cn) 下载各类教育资源。项目地址: https://gitcode.com/gh_mirrors/kn/knowledge-grab

🎯 核心价值:三大下载难题的完美解答

问题一:资源分散难以集中管理智慧教育平台资源分散在不同页面和课程中,手动逐个下载耗时耗力。knowledge-grab通过智能识别技术,实现一键批量获取,大幅提升工作效率。

问题二:跨平台兼容性不足传统下载工具往往局限于特定操作系统。knowledge-grab采用现代化技术架构,完美支持Windows、macOS和Linux三大主流平台。

问题三:文件整理繁琐下载后的资源需要手动分类整理。该工具支持按学科、年级和资源类型自动分类,建立清晰的文件夹结构。

⚡ 具体功能:一站式下载管理体验

智能批量下载

通过教材列表页实现快速资源获取:

  • 输入课程关键词智能搜索
  • 多选需要下载的课件和视频
  • 自动处理下载队列和文件命名

分类管理系统

内置多维度分类逻辑:

  • 学科维度:数学、语文、英语等主要科目
  • 年级维度:小学、初中、高中全阶段覆盖
  • 资源类型:课件、视频、习题等多样化素材

个性化配置选项

在设置页面可灵活调整:

  • 自定义默认下载路径
  • 设置同时下载任务数量
  • 选择文件命名规则格式

🔧 技术实现:稳定可靠的技术架构

knowledge-grab采用Rust语言构建后端核心,确保下载过程的稳定性和安全性。前端基于Vue 3框架,提供流畅的用户交互体验。Tauri框架的运用实现了原生应用的性能表现。

主要技术模块包括:

  • 下载引擎:src-tauri/src/downloader.rs
  • API接口:src-tauri/src/api.rs
  • 数据模型:src-tauri/src/models.rs

📋 快速上手:三步完成安装部署

环境准备

确保系统已安装:

  • Node.js LTS版本
  • Rust开发环境
  • 相应构建工具

安装步骤

git clone https://gitcode.com/gh_mirrors/kn/knowledge-grab cd knowledge-grab pnpm install pnpm tauri dev

首次使用

启动应用后即可开始:

  1. 浏览教材资源列表
  2. 选择需要下载的课程
  3. 点击开始下载按钮

💡 实用技巧:提升下载效率的方法

批量操作策略

  • 按学期规划下载任务
  • 优先下载核心课程资源
  • 利用空闲时间进行后台下载

文件管理建议

  • 定期整理下载文件夹
  • 建立个人资源标签体系
  • 备份重要教学素材

🛠️ 故障排除:常见问题解决方案

下载失败处理

遇到403错误时可尝试:

  • 检查网络连接状态
  • 确认目标资源有效性
  • 更新至最新版本

系统兼容性

针对不同操作系统的特殊处理:

  • macOS安全设置调整
  • Windows权限配置
  • Linux依赖安装

通过knowledge-grab教育资源下载工具,教师能够快速构建个人教学资源库,学生可以轻松获取优质学习材料。这款跨平台下载软件不仅解决了批量下载课件的技术难题,更为数字化教育提供了强有力的工具支持。

【免费下载链接】knowledge-grabknowledge-grab 是一个基于 Tauri 和 Vue 3 构建的桌面应用程序,方便用户从 国家中小学智慧教育平台 (basic.smartedu.cn) 下载各类教育资源。项目地址: https://gitcode.com/gh_mirrors/kn/knowledge-grab

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/7 4:57:12

使用Miniconda-Python3.11运行代码补全Copilot类模型

使用Miniconda-Python3.11运行代码补全Copilot类模型 在AI编程助手日益普及的今天,越来越多开发者开始尝试本地部署像StarCoder、CodeGen或CodeLlama这类开源“Copilot级”代码补全模型。然而,一个常见的困境是:明明在教程里几行命令就能跑通…

作者头像 李华
网站建设 2026/3/20 22:36:13

PyTorch安装教程GPU版本|Miniconda-Python3.11配合cudatoolkit11.7

PyTorch GPU 版本安装指南:基于 Miniconda、Python 3.11 与 cudatoolkit 11.7 的高效实践 在深度学习项目开发中,一个稳定且高效的运行环境是成功的基础。然而,许多开发者,尤其是初学者,常常被 PyTorch 的 GPU 环境配置…

作者头像 李华
网站建设 2026/4/11 21:32:10

15分钟零代码搭建H5页面可视化编辑器:免费开源的终极选择

15分钟零代码搭建H5页面可视化编辑器:免费开源的终极选择 【免费下载链接】quark-h5 基于vue2 koa2的 H5制作工具。让不会写代码的人也能轻松快速上手制作H5页面。类似易企秀、百度H5等H5制作、建站工具 项目地址: https://gitcode.com/gh_mirrors/qu/quark-h5 …

作者头像 李华
网站建设 2026/4/15 17:27:52

Nucleus Co-op分屏游戏配置完全攻略

Nucleus Co-op分屏游戏配置完全攻略 【免费下载链接】splitscreenme-nucleus Nucleus Co-op is an application that starts multiple instances of a game for split-screen multiplayer gaming! 项目地址: https://gitcode.com/gh_mirrors/spl/splitscreenme-nucleus …

作者头像 李华
网站建设 2026/3/26 2:42:10

BongoCat桌面宠物:解锁实时互动的数字伴侣新体验

BongoCat桌面宠物:解锁实时互动的数字伴侣新体验 【免费下载链接】BongoCat 让呆萌可爱的 Bongo Cat 陪伴你的键盘敲击与鼠标操作,每一次输入都充满趣味与活力! 项目地址: https://gitcode.com/gh_mirrors/bong/BongoCat 在数字时代&a…

作者头像 李华
网站建设 2026/4/16 10:55:58

Markdown表格渲染异常?Miniconda-Python3.11中修正mistune解析器

Markdown表格渲染异常?Miniconda-Python3.11中修正mistune解析器 在构建AI科研与数据科学项目时,一个看似不起眼的问题——Jupyter Notebook中的Markdown表格无法正常显示——却可能严重影响实验记录的可读性和团队协作效率。尤其是在使用轻量级但功能强…

作者头像 李华